Understanding the Pen Ink Composition

The type of pen ink will determine the most effective cleaning method. Ballpoint pen ink is oil-based and requires a solvent to dissolve it. Gel pens use water-based ink that can be removed with water or rubbing alcohol. Understanding the ink composition will help you choose the appropriate cleaning solution and avoid damaging the fabric.

Testing the Cleaning Solution

Before applying any cleaning solution to the entire ink stain, test it on an inconspicuous area of the sofa. This will ensure that the solution does not discolor or damage the fabric. Apply a small amount of the solution to the test area and wait a few minutes to observe any reactions.

Using the Appropriate Cleaning Method

For oil-based inks, such as those from ballpoint pens, use a solvent like rubbing alcohol or nail polish remover. Apply the solvent to a clean cloth and dab at the ink stain. Do not rub, as this can spread the ink. For water-based inks, such as those from gel pens, use water or rubbing alcohol. Apply the solution to the ink stain and blot with a clean cloth.

Neutralizing the Stain

After removing the ink, neutralize the stain to prevent it from reappearing. For oil-based inks, apply a few drops of white vinegar to the area and blot with a clean cloth. For water-based inks, use a solution of one part hydrogen peroxide to three parts water. Apply the solution to the stain and blot with a clean cloth.

Rinsing and Drying

Rinse the area with clean water to remove any remaining cleaning solution or ink residue. Use a clean cloth or sponge to blot up the excess water. Allow the area to air dry completely before using the sofa again.
